2026 IEEE International Conference on Cyber Resilience and Endogenous Safety & Security

1793203200000Nanjing, Jiangsu, ChinaOfficial conference site Site reachable

IEEE CRESS 2026 is the International Conference on Cyber Resilience and Endogenous Safety & Security, aiming to bring together researchers and practitioners to share advances in cyber defense, secure system design, and resilience of digital systems against sophisticated threats. The conference focuses on innovative theories, methodologies, and technologies for securing networks, critical infrastructures, AI-enabled systems, and emerging communication platforms like 5G/6G and satellite internet.

Full Papers

Original research findings and practical experiences in English, 6-8 pages in IEEE proceedings format, including references and illustrations.

Policies worth checking twice

  • Papers must be original and not under review or published elsewhere at submission time.
  • Authors must not submit the same paper elsewhere during the review period.
  • Plagiarism is utterly intolerant; submitted work must be the authors' own with proper citations.
  • Accepted papers require at least one author to register and present at the conference.
  • Violations of plagiarism policies result in rejection, institutional reporting, and potential public disclosure of misconduct.
